Red Cliffs Lodge lies 14 miles up the Colorado River on scenic Highway 128 from downtown Moab beside white water rapids and at the foot of stunning red rock cliffs. Several movies were shot here including Rio Grande with John Wayne and the lodge maintains the Moab Movie Museum, telling the story of film-making in the area. The main building is surrounded by porches and decks while the restaurant patio and deck face eastwards up the river with an uninterrupted view of Fisher Towers 10 miles away and the river 100 feet beneath. Red Cliffs Lodge is also the home of the Castle Creek Winery, the largest in Utah, with daily opportunities for tastings and The Cowboy Grill, a terraced dining room with tasty Western cuisine and great Colorado River views.
